Watch out for

vine weevil in containers: Biological control with Steinernema kraussei nematodes in late summer or early autumn; pot hygiene and fresh compost each year per RHS advice.

grey mould (Botrytis cinerea) in damp winters: Remove and bin infected material; space pots so air can circulate; avoid overhead watering on the rosette per RHS.

powdery mildew in dry springs: Do not crowd plants; water at the base rather than overhead; remove affected leaves promptly. Fungicide is not a first-line treatment in RHS guidance.

slugs and snails on flower stems: Nematode Phasmarhabditis hermaphrodita in autumn; hand-picking at dusk; beer traps; copper rings around patio pots per RHS.

root rot in heavy wet soil: Raise the bed by 10–15 cm, plant in pots, or use a 50:50 mix of John Innes No. 2 and coarse grit; raise pots on pot feet so drainage holes clear standing water.
